    Abstract: An advanced system of cooperating solar module carrier robots for installing solar panels is provided. The system includes a computer vision system designed to route the cooperating solar module carrier robots to the solar tracker. The system also includes a robotic arm with a suction cup tool designed to pick up and hold a solar panel. The suction cup tool can include a set of suction cups, an actuator designed to create a vacuum in each suction cup of the set of suction cups. The suction cup tool also has an air nozzle designed to below off debris on a surface of the solar panel.

    Abstract: A cable sleeve for use with a safety cable of a fall protection system. The cable sleeve has a braking system that includes a constant-contact wheel, a rotor that is connected to the constant-contact wheel, a cam plate, and a braking shoe. The rotor may have a permanent magnet and a magnetically susceptible item that is held in a disengaged position by the permanent magnet. Rotation of the constant-contact wheel can overcome the magnetic force and cause the item to move so as to engage with the cam plate and actuate braking by the braking shoe.

    Abstract: A cable guide for stabilizing a safety cable of a fall protection system. The cable guide includes an elongate member with an engaging end that is arcuately deflectable relative to a stationary end of the elongate member and that comprises a magnet.

    Abstract: Embodiments described herein disclose methods and systems for using more than one Recurrent Neural Network (RNN) to analyze a user input and to predict a request being made by the user as the user is inputting the request. In an embodiment, a first RNN and a second RNN can simultaneously or near simultaneously process the user requested information by separating and analyzing the characters and words in the user's request. A third RNN can process the output vectors generated by the first and second RNNs to identify one or more solutions that predict the user's request.

    Abstract: A monitoring device for monitoring a screw joint of an object includes a base plate to be attached to the object and a top plate to be attached to one part of the screw joint, wherein the base plate and the top plate are positioned parallel to and on top of each other and wherein both plates each includes at least one electrode that capacitively interact with each other. The monitoring device is characterized in that the electrodes are shaped and positioned such that at least one electrode of one of the plates interacts with at least two different electrodes of the other one of the plates depending on the rotational position of the plates relative to each other. A monitoring arrangement having at least one monitoring device of this kind and a monitoring method are also provided.

    Abstract: Rigid wadding, insulation and packaging for food and other products is made of homogeneous polyester terephthalate (PET) that satisfies the resin recycling identification code number one. For purposes of protecting an inner rigid wadding or other insulation, one or more film strips or film coatings may be applied by the artful use of amorphous (non-crystalized) PET that melts at a lower temperature and can act as a thermal bond adhesive. The film strips or film coatings may be made of homogeneous polyester terephthalate (PET) that satisfies the resin recycling identification code number one.
